cbs_av1: Reject thirty-two zero bits in uvlc code The spec allows at least thirty-two zero bits followed by a one to mean 2^32-1, with no constraint on the number of zeroes. The libaom reference decoder does not match this, instead reading thirty-two zeroes but not the following one to mean 2^32-1. These two interpretations are incompatible and other implementations may follow one or the other. Therefore reject thirty-two zeroes because the intended behaviour is not clear.
